Stuttering Cube
I have a Sapphire Radeon 9250, the cube in ATITool rotates for 2/3 seconds, then stops for 0.5 seconds and then resumes rotation. Is that normal, or maybe a bug (because I have seen this problem reported in your TODO list).

same "problem" here!
Made a clean xp install and it works fine! After installation of my needed tools (running background) again the same thing....stuttering!Found out if I stop several little program running background (in tray) the cube circles better and then perfect ... dont know if that can be fixed.... dont have the problem with ATI Tray tools for example |

Same problem here - it's MBM5 causing it for me. Exit MBM5 and it's fine. Start it, and the cube does it's little stop and go.
